Alliance told: prove your claims

by isleofman.com 12th March 2012

An education group’s been told to back up its claim that the quality of care and education could improve when government funded pre-schools are transferred into the private sector.

The Manx Early Years Alliance believes private nurseries offer a better service than state run units, helped by a smaller child-staff ratio with more monitoring and age-specific activities.

Secretary of the Association of Teachers and Lecturers, Andrew Shipley, disagrees and says such comments denigrate the skills of trained teachers in public facilities.
